Employment-Based Immigration

Some foreign workers are able to obtain permanent residency in the United States, while many others receive temporary visas. While the immigration process is much more technical and more difficult than in other types of immigration cases, an experienced immigration lawyer can help you, a loved one or an employee apply for permanent residency or for an H-1B visa.immigration lawyers

An H-1B visa is typically granted to workers with specialized knowledge and higher education relevant to a particular type of job. Investment Visas

The United States government awards nonimmigrant visas and permanent resident (green card) status to foreign investors and business owners who can demonstrate significant financial commitment, hire workers, and otherwise contribute to the economy. Our firm can assist you in pursuing investment-based visas such as:

An E-2 visa: An E-2 treaty investor visa is designed for foreign nationals from countries with which the United States has relevant treaties. In order to obtain an E-2 visa, an applicant must meet specific criteria with regard to the size of the investment, nature of the business, and participation in the operations of the business.
An L-1 visa: An L-1A visa, valid for up to seven years, can be obtained for certain executive or managerial transferees within a company doing significant business in the United States. An L1-B visa, valid for up to five years, can be obtained for employees with special knowledge or skills.
